Bertha Chan Hiu Yau is one of the very few fat acceptance and body positivity advocates in Hong Kong. Struggling to reach the “healthy” weight and BMI for her whole life, she faces discrimination in many aspects of her daily living. Be it finding a job, looking for a spouse, or finding clothes to wear. Everything is telling her, she is abnormal, being a fat Chinese woman in Hong Kong. She is either not thin enough to be normal, not fat enough to be plus size, or not fit enough to be called curvy; but from the doctor’s point of view, she is obese in Hong Kong. At the same time, she is considered of average size in the West.
